Analysis
The most recent figure for cocaine use disorder deaths by sex in Nicaragua is 0.6 deaths, measured in 2021.
The figure is down 31.8% on the previous year and up 122.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, cocaine use disorder deaths by sex in Nicaragua peaked at 1.96 deaths in 2009 and was at its lowest, 0 deaths, in 2003.
That places Nicaragua 90th out of 194 countries with data for 2021,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
